Role is in Health Information Management (Release of Information) and involves working with ADT and health records systems, privacy legislation (FOIPPA), and health records/data governance—core eHealth/health informatics functions.
In accordance with the Vision, Purpose, and Values, and strategic direction of the Vancouver Island Health Authority (Island Health), patient and staff safety is a priority and a responsibility shared by everyone; as such, the requirement to continuously improve quality and safety is inherent in all aspects of this position.
Reporting to the Coordinator, Release of Information, the Health Information Management (HIM) Professional - Release of Information (ROI) provides release of information services for the multi-site operations in South, Central and North Island, in accordance with established policies and procedures and applicable legislation; acts as health records release of information liaison with appropriate individuals or agencies as necessary.
Travel may be a requirement of this position. Transportation arrangements must meet the operational requirements of Island Health in accordance with the service assignment and may require the use of a personal vehicle.
Graduate of an approved Health Information Management Professional program. Certification with the Canadian College of Health Information Management Health Records Administrators at the Certificant Level (CHIM). Eligible for membership in the Canadian Health Information Management Association.
Knowledge of applicable legislation, such as the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act; Knowledge of and experience with ADT and Health Records Systems; and one (1) year recent, related experience; or an equivalent combination of education, training and experience.
Valid BC Driver's License.
